GS Caltex Plans Ethylene/PE Complex

13.02.2018 -

South Korean oil refiner GS Caltex is to enter the ethylene/PE market with plans to invest approximately 2 trillion won (€1.5 billion) in an integrated facility in Yeosu.

The plant would produce 700,000 t/y of ethylene from a mixed feed cracker and 500,000 t/y of PE. Design work will start this year with construction scheduled to begin during 2019 and plant start-up by 2022.

GS Caltex said it has decided to invest in ethylene/PE production in order to diversify its current business, which is centered on refining and aromatics. According to market research company IHS, the global PE market accounts for the largest share (100 million t/y) of the 260 million t/y of ethylene produced globally, with world demand growing at 4.2% per year.

The Seoul-headquartered group added that it expects to gain a competitive advantage and create synergies by linking the ethylene/PE complex with its existing production facilities. It also anticipates generating additional operating profit of more than 400 billion won annually by expanding its portfolio to include new petrochemical products.

The company currently operates a crude oil refinery with a capacity of 790,000 barrels per day along with aromatics production of 2.8 million t/y. GS Caltex also runs a PP plant with a capacity of 180,000 t/y.
